How Can I Create A Strong Portfolio To Attract Clients As A Freelance Virtual Assistant?

As a freelance VA, creating a strong portfolio is essential for attracting potential clients and showcasing your skills, experience, and value proposition. A well-crafted portfolio serves as a powerful marketing tool that can differentiate you from competitors and increase your chances of securing new projects.

Key Elements Of A Strong Portfolio

Professional and Visually Appealing Design:

  • Choose a clean, modern, and easy-to-navigate design.
  • Ensure your portfolio is mobile-friendly for easy access on various devices.

Clear and Concise About Me Section:

  • Craft a compelling that showcases your skills, experience, and unique value proposition.
  • Use bullet points to highlight your key strengths and achievements.

Relevant Work Samples:

  • Include a diverse range of work samples that demonstrate your versatility and expertise.
  • Organize samples into categories or projects for easy navigation.
  • Provide brief descriptions and context for each sample.

Client Testimonials and Reviews:

  • Gather positive feedback and testimonials from past clients.
  • Display these testimonials prominently to build credibility and trust.

Skills and Services Offered:

  • List the specific skills and services you offer as a virtual assistant.
  • Use bullet points to make your offerings easy to scan and understand.

Contact Information:

  • Make it easy for potential clients to reach you by including your contact information.
  • Consider adding a contact form for convenience.

Additional Tips For Creating A Strong Portfolio

Keep It Updated:

  • Regularly add new work samples and testimonials to keep your portfolio fresh and relevant.

Tailor It to Your Target Audience:

  • Customize your portfolio to appeal to your ideal client persona.
  • Highlight skills and experience that are particularly relevant to their needs.

Use High-Quality Images and Videos:

  • Incorporate visually appealing images and videos to showcase your work and engage visitors.

Proofread and Edit:

  • Ensure your portfolio is free of grammatical errors and typos.
  • Have someone else review it for a fresh perspective.
